About the Book

A memoir of a minority woman growing up in the ghettos of New York City shows how anyone can become someone successful. Although, Mirian’s struggles started from birth she firmly believed in many things such as castles, knights in shining armor, and a big house with a picket fence. It was those dreams that kept her spirit alive when life became too horrendously painful. Mirian Detres was not only born disabled, but she has been mentally, physically, and sexually abused. Her memoirs include being locked in a closet at the age of 9 for a year, hospitalized in a mental institution as an adult for approx. 2 years and received shock treatments, been beaten as a wife, a druggy and living in the streets as a homeless woman with her babies. It was the love she had for her children that caused her to go through a metamorphosis in life. The change was so drastic, that not even her own family recognized her. Mirian Detres’s memoirs not only takes you into a world of poverty, abuse, and neglect but it plunges the reader into a dark rabbit hole of struggles with drugs and crime only to come out on the other side as an educational scholar with two masters, doctorate of philosophy, spokes person for battered women, and a successful mother of five children. This is a true story of  a woman without any role models became one herself.


About the Author

The author is a woman born and raised in the South Bronx of New York City. Her religious experiences as a small child were attending Friday night séances. Both her parents and grandparents were believers and involved in “Mesa Blanca”, which is “White Table” spiritualism. They were considered witches of white magic and some were healers. Her experiences were both frightening and life changing. She thought her parents were schizophrenic until she began to experience the paranormal herself. This drove her into the world of Haitian Voodoo and away from the white magic realm. Today, she is a well known Medium, baptized in the 21 divisions of Voodoo, Santeria and Palo. She is a high priestess and an elder in Santeria. She is well known for her witchcraft and prophetic excellent skills. This book contains short stories of her paranormal experiences while growing up in a world of spirits and witchcraft
